The default objective function in NONMEM is that of ELS, and it can be positive or negative depending on DV units, number of measurements, etc. In NONMEM V, it is possible to select an objective function equal to likelihood or -2*log(likelihood) by including LIKELIHOOD or -2LOGLIKELIHOOD option, respectively, in $ESTIMATION.
